Connecticut Pewter Gill Mug , c. 1795-1820
Not often found marked, these gill size mugs were made by Samuel Danforth and his nephew Thomas Danforth
Boardman of Hartford Connecticut. Although termed "mugs" since they have a similar form to their larger
brethren, these small size versions (standing 2-1/2" to the rim) were most likely used as measures.
This mug (measure) is in good condition.
